Chiropractic Coaching Tip # 2
During the development of our practice I noticed that many chiropractors have various levels of participation in the practices some full engaged and some not at all. The truth be told if many chiropractors feel that they need to be at there practices and do not necessarily want to be there.
Todays challenge is to sit back for five minutes in your chair. Close your eyes and imagine 5 things you can do this week to make your experience at the practice better. I want you to think about what your Chiropractic Coaching team would tell you to do? What do you think that would help you and your wellness program in you chiropractic everyday practice?
The always start with the simple things. It seems to ground me and then I work onto the harder object to manipulate in the office.
Start with that report that you have been putting off. Then move to something like talking to the chiropractic assistant you "have been meaning to talk to". After, you have focused on about 4 things you can do easy-to moderate. Pick one thing that if you could get done you would be exstatic.
Write those five things down on two pieces of paper. Put the first piece of paper on your desk where you keep your chiropractic management tips. The second Chiropractic Coaching tips goes in your bathroom at your home. Do these simple things in your life and you will see a profound change in your life and practice.
